Introduction to Sustainability in Software Development
Definition of Sustainability
Sustainability in software development refers to creating applications that minimize environmental impact. This approach considers energy efficiency, resource conservation, and waste reduction. It is essential for developers to adopt practices that promote long-term ecological balance. Every small change can make a difference . By prioritizing sustainability, he contributes to a healthier planet. Isn’t that a worthy goal?
Importance of Eco-Friendly Practices
Eco-friendly practices in software development are crucial for reducing operational costs and enhancing corporate social responsibility. By implementing sustainable methodologies, he can optimize resource allocation and minimize waste. This approach often leads to improved financial performance. Sustainable practices yield long-term savings. Isn’t it smart to invest in the future? Companies that prioritize eco-friendliness attract socially conscious investors.
Overview of the Gaming Industry’s Impact
The gaming industry significantly impacts the environment through energy consumption and electronic waste. For instance, data centers and gaming consoles contribute to high carbon emissions. Additionally, the production and disposal of hardware create substantial waste. This is a pressing issue.
Key impacts include:
Addressing these concerns is essential. Every action counts. Sustainable practices can mitigate these effects.
Understanding the Environmental Impact of Software
Carbon Footprint of Software Development
The carbon footprint of software development encompasses energy consumption and resource utilization throughout the software lifecycle. This includes coding, testing, and deployment phases. Each stage contributes to greenhouse gas emissions. Reducing these emissions can enhance profitability.
Key factors include:
Sustainable practices can lower costs. Isn’t that a smart strategy? Companies can improve their market position.
Energy Consumption in Gaming
Energy consumption in gaming is a significant concern due to the high power requirements of consoles and gaming PCs. This demand leads to increased electricity usage, contributing to higher carbon emissions. Additionally, online gaming platforms require substantial server energy. Every watt counts in this industry.
Key contributors include:
He must consider energy-efficient options. Sustainable choices can reduce costs. Isn’t it time to act?
Waste Generation from Hardware and Software
Waste generation from hardware and software poses significant environmental challenges. The rapid turnover of devices leads to increased electronic waste. This waste often contains hazardous materials that can harm ecosystems. Proper disposal is crucial for sustainability.
Key issues include:
He should prioritize recycling programs. Every effort matters. Sustainable practices can mitigate waste impact.
Eco-Friendly Software Development Practices
Green Coding Techniques
Green coding techniques focus on optimizing software for energy efficiency and redufed resource consumption. By employing efficient algorithms, developers can minimize processing power and energy use. This approach not only lowers operational costs but also enhances performance.
Key strategies include:
He should adopt these practices. Every optimization counts. Sustainable coding is a smart investment.
Efficient Resource Management
Efficient resource management in software development is essential for minimizing costs and environmental impact. By optimizing resource allocation, he can enhance productivity while reducing waste. This practice leads to significant financial savings over time.
Key components include:
He should implement these strategies. Every resource matters. Sustainable management is a wise choice.
Utilizing Open Source Solutions
Utilizing open source solutions can significantly reduce software development costs while promoting sustainability. These solutions often require fewer resources for licensing and maintenance. Additionally, they foster collaboration and innovation within the developer community.
Key benefits include:
He should consider these options. Every choice impacts sustainability. Open source is a smart investment.
Implementing Sustainable Practices in Game Design
Designing for Longevity
Designing for longevity in game development enhances both player engagement and resource efficiency. By creating games that remain relevant over time, developers can reduce the need for frequent updates and new releases. This approach leads to lower production costs and increased profitability.
Key strategies include:
He should prioritize these practices. Every decision matters. Longevity benefits both players and developers.
Incorporating Eco-Themes in Gameplay
Incorporating eco-themes in gameplay can enhance player awareness of environmental issues. By integrating sustainability concepts, developers can create engaging narratives that resonate with players. This approach not only educates but also fosters a sense of responsibility.
Key elements include:
He should embrace these themes. Every game can inspire change. Eco-conscious gameplay is impactful.
Reducing In-Game Resource Consumption
Reducing in-game resource consumption is essential for promoting sustainability in game design. By optimizing mechanics and minimizing unnecessary features, developers can create more efficient gameplay experiences. This not only enhances performance but also reduces the overall environmental impact.
Key strategies include:
He should implement these techniques. Every optimization helps the environment. Sustainable design is a smart choice.
Case Studies of Sustainable Game Development
Successful Eco-Friendly Games
Successful eco-friendly games demonstrate the potential for sustainable development in the gaming manufacture. For instance, “Eco” encourages players to build ecosystems while managing resources responsibly. This game effectively combines entertainment with environmental education .
Key examples include:
He should explore these titles. Eco-friendly games are impactful.
Lessons Learned from Industry Leaders
Lessons learned from industry leaders highlight effective sustainable practices in game development. For example, companies like Ubisoft focus on reducing carbon footprints through energy-efficient technologies. This commitment enhances their brand reputation and attracts eco-conscious consumers.
Key takeaways include:
He should adopt these strategies. Every lesson is valuable. Sustainable practices yield long-term benefits.
Innovative Approaches to Sustainability
Innovative approaches to sustainability in game development include the use of virtual reality to simulate environmental impacts. This technology allows players to experience the consequences of their actions in a controlled setting. Additionally, some developers are integrating real-world conservation efforts into gameplay.
Key innovations include:
He should explore these methods. Every innovation counts. Sustainable gaming can inspire change.
Tools and Technologies for Sustainable Development
Green Software Development Tools
Green software development tools are essential for promoting sustainability in coding practices. These tools help developers optimize their applications for energy efficiency and resource conservation. By utilizing such technologies, companies can significantly reduce their carbon footprint.
Key tools include:
He should consider these options. Every tool makes a difference. Sustainable development is a smart investment.
Cloud Computing and Its Benefits
Cloud computing offers significant benefits for sustainable development by optimizing resource utilization and reducing energy consumption. By leveraging shared infrastructure, companies can minimize their carbon footprint while enhancing operational efficiency. This model allows for scalable solutions that adapt to demand.
Key advantages include:
He should explore these benefits. Cloud solutions are efficient.
Monitoring and Reporting Tools for Sustainability
Monitoring and reporting tools for sustainability are essential for tracking environmental performance and compliance. These tools enable organizations to assess their carbon footprint and resource usage effectively. By providing real-time data, they facilitate informed decision-making.
Key features include:
He should utilize these tools. Every metric matters. Sustainable practices require accurate reporting.
The Future of Sustainability in the Gaming Industry
Trends in Eco-Friendly Game Development
Trends in eco-friendly game development are shaping the future of the gaming industry. Increasingly, developers are prioritizing sustainability by integrating green practices into their workfiows. This shift not only reduces environmental impact but also appeals to a growing demographic of eco-conscious consumers.
Key trends include:
He should stay informed about these trends. Every trend influences market dynamics. Sustainable gaming is the future.
Regulatory and Consumer Pressures
Regulatory and consumer pressures are driving the gaming industry toward greater sustainability. Governments are increasingly implementing regulations that require companies to disclose their environmental impact. This trend compels developers to adopt eco-friendly practices to remain compliant.
Key pressures include:
He should recognize these pressures. Every regulation influences business strategy. Sustainable practices are becoming essential.
Building a Sustainable Gaming Community
Building a sustainable gaming community requires collaboration among developers, players, and stakeholders. By fostering awareness of environmental issues, the community can drive positive change. Engaging players in sustainability initiatives enhances their connection to the games.
Key strategies include:
He should participate in these efforts. Every action contributes to sustainability. A united community can make a difference.